Common Issues in Google Jobs Data Collection
Technical Barriers and Solutions
Collecting data from Google Jobs comes with its own set of technical hurdles. CAPTCHA challenges, dynamic content, and IP blocks often disrupt traditional scraping methods. To navigate these obstacles, specialized tools and strategies are essential.
For dynamically loaded content, tools like Selenium and Puppeteer work well. To avoid IP blocks, rotating IP addresses through proxy networks is a must. Adding rate-limiting protocols - delays between requests - can also help reduce the risk of triggering anti-scraping defenses.
Here’s a structured approach to tackle these challenges:
- Browser automation: Use tools like Selenium for handling JavaScript-heavy pages.
- Request management: Introduce intelligent rate limits to avoid detection.
- IP rotation: Employ proxy networks to maintain uninterrupted access.
Data Quality Control Methods
Once technical barriers are addressed, the focus shifts to ensuring high-quality data. Raw data often contains errors or inconsistencies, so cleaning and standardizing it is critical.
Key quality control measures include:
Quality Control Step | Purpose | Implementation Method |
---|---|---|
Data Validation | Verify accuracy and completeness | Automated checks for missing or incorrect data |
Duplicate Detection | Eliminate redundant job listings | Use hash-based algorithms for comparisons |
Format Standardization | Ensure uniform data structure | Apply custom parsing scripts |
Currency Conversion | Standardize salary data formats | Integrate real-time exchange rate tools |
Legal Requirements and Ethics
Data collection must also align with legal and ethical standards. Regulations like the U.S. Computer Fraud and Abuse Act (CFAA) and the EU's General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) establish clear boundaries for data scraping activities.
To stay compliant, organizations should:
- Follow robots.txt directives.
- Avoid collecting Personally Identifiable Information (PII).
- Maintain transparency in data collection practices.
- Keep detailed records of scraping activities.
Legal precedent suggests that scraping public data is generally permissible under CFAA as long as no technical barriers are bypassed.
Critical compliance actions include:
- Reviewing and adhering to Google Jobs' terms of service.
- Implementing strong data protection measures.
- Staying updated on changes in relevant legal frameworks.
Tools for Google Jobs Data Collection
Python-Based Data Collection
Python is a go-to language for gathering data from Google Jobs, thanks to its powerful libraries. Tools like BeautifulSoup and Scrapy are excellent for parsing HTML, while Selenium is ideal for handling job listings loaded with JavaScript. Python's ecosystem makes it a popular choice for this task.
Here’s how these tools are typically used together:
Tool | Primary Function | Use Case |
---|---|---|
BeautifulSoup | HTML/XML parsing | Static job listings |
Scrapy | Large-scale crawling | High-volume data extraction |
Selenium | Browser automation | Dynamic content handling |
Proxy Management for Data Access
Effective proxy management is essential for smooth data collection from Google Jobs. A strong proxy network helps spread requests across multiple IPs, reducing the likelihood of rate limits or blocks. This step is critical for consistent access.
Key proxy features to consider:
Proxy Feature | Purpose | Impact |
---|---|---|
IP Rotation | Distribute requests | Prevents IP bans |
Geographic Distribution | Access region-specific data | Improves data precision |
Request Rate Control | Manage traffic flow | Ensures stable connections |

What are the main technical challenges of scraping Google Jobs and how can they be solved effectively?
Scraping Google Jobs comes with several technical challenges, including CAPTCHAs, dynamic content, and IP blocking. These barriers are designed to prevent automated access but can be effectively managed with the right tools and strategies.
To handle CAPTCHAs, automation tools like Selenium or specialized CAPTCHA-solving services can be used. For dynamic content loaded via JavaScript, frameworks such as Selenium or Puppeteer are ideal for rendering and extracting the needed data. IP blocking, which happens when too many requests are sent in a short time, can be mitigated by using proxies, rotating IP addresses, and implementing rate limiting to ensure requests are spread out over time.
By combining these techniques, businesses can successfully navigate the technical hurdles of scraping Google Jobs and gain valuable insights for strategic decision-making.
